Expanding Memory Horizons: The Microchip 23LC1024T-I/SN 1-Mbit SPI Serial SRAM

In the world of embedded systems and IoT devices, where efficient data handling and low power consumption are paramount, the choice of memory can be a critical design decision. The Microchip 23LC1024T-I/SN stands out as a highly capable and versatile solution, offering 1 Megabit of high-speed Serial SRAM accessible through a simple SPI interface. This memory chip provides a unique blend of SRAM performance and serial interface convenience, making it an ideal choice for a wide range of applications.

A key advantage of this device is its full SPI bus compatibility, supporting modes 0 and 1. This allows for seamless communication with a vast majority of microcontrollers and processors that feature a standard Serial Peripheral Interface. With a maximum clock frequency of 20 MHz, it enables rapid data transfer, which is crucial for applications requiring real-time data logging, buffering, or storage of rapidly changing variables. Unlike non-volatile memory, this SRAM does not require a lengthy write cycle or wear-leveling algorithms, guaranteeing fast, unlimited read and write cycles with no degradation over time.

The 23LC1024T-I/SN is organized as 128K x 8 bits, providing a straightforward and easy-to-manage memory space. Its operation is incredibly power-efficient, featuring a low active current and a standby current of just a few microamps. This makes it perfectly suited for battery-powered and portable devices where every microwatt counts. Furthermore, the chip includes a built-in hardware data protection feature via a hold pin, allowing the host to pause serial communication without resetting the entire sequence, which is essential in noisy environments or multi-device SPI networks.

Housed in a compact 8-lead SOIC (SN) package, this memory chip is designed for space-constrained PCB designs. Its industrial temperature range (-40°C to +85°C) ensures reliable operation in harsh environmental conditions, broadening its applicability from consumer electronics to industrial automation and automotive systems. Designers often leverage this SRAM to offload a microcontroller's internal RAM, serve as a shared memory space in multi-master systems, or act as a high-speed buffer for data acquisition.
